Requirements
- 10+ years of experience in the payments or fintech industry.
- At least 8 years in strategic partnerships, business development, or enterprise account management.
- Demonstrated success in owning commercial negotiations and managing multi-million dollar partnerships.
- Proven ability to craft and execute partner strategies resulting in measurable business growth.
- Deep knowledge of global payment methods, financial products, and cross-border payout solutions.
- Understanding of payments cost structure, including interchange, chargebacks, FX, and treasury flow.
- Experience in resolving partner conflicts or escalations across multiple markets or regulatory contexts.
- Experience in marketplace or platform models with a focus on cross-border payouts.
- Experience advising internal stakeholders on partner enablement strategy.
- Experience working with regulators or regulated partners.
- Advanced degree or MBA is a plus.
Responsibilities
- Define and evolve payout partner strategy to ensure performance, coverage, and alignment with Airbnb’s financial goals.
- Identify partners in each market, structure new deals, and renegotiate existing relationships for cost, reach, and innovation.
- Lead global deal execution, including developing commercial structures and navigating regional regulatory constraints.
- Cultivate executive-level relationships with financial institutions, banks, and payment processors to ensure Airbnb remains a priority client.
- Monitor partner performance and lead cross-functional efforts to address issues, resolve escalations, and evolve terms.
- Collaborate with internal teams including Legal, Treasury, Risk, Product, and Engineering to scale payout infrastructure.
